## Configuration

Scrubjay strips EXIF metadata from uploads before they reach the CDN. Set `SCRUB_MODE=strict` in production; `lenient` keeps orientation tags. If the queue backs up, raise `SCRUB_WORKERS` to 8. The scrubber authenticates to the Pellmark asset store with a token from the environment, which belongs on the next line of the env file:

vault entry, yahif-yajep: COURIER_KEY29=b802bdf8034096b65a51c6ba5abe2

Handover: Quillgate circuit breaker for the Fernwick upstream API. Breaker trips after five consecutive 5xx responses within 30 seconds and holds open for two minutes before half-open probing. During the open state, cached quotes are served with a staleness header. Tonight's deploy lowered the probe interval, so expect more frequent flapping in the graphs until traffic settles. Do not manually reset the breaker unless Fernwick confirms recovery on their side. Current breaker state and trip history are visible on the internal dashboard.

runbook for badug-kadup: https://confluence.zemvarlabs.internal/projects/browse/display/projects/bd1b

Subject: Handover — retention sweeper release

Taking off Friday. Sweeper v3.2 for Corvane is staged; dry-run passed on the Melk cluster. Outstanding: sign the final bundle and push before the retention window closes Sunday. Config unchanged from v3.1. Logs go to the usual bucket. Don't skip the checksum step. Sign the release bundle with the key below.

signing key of bagap-yawep = bky13_TbfT6ZMUoGJo2